
The most widely-read mystery of all time, now a major motion picture directed by Kenneth Branagh and produced by Ridley Scott<br/>“What more…can a mystery addict desire?” —New York Times<br/><br/>“The murderer is with us—on the train now . . .”<br/>Just after midnight, the famous Orient Express is stopped in its tracks by a snowdrift. By morning, the millionaire Samuel Edward Ratchett lies dead in his compartment, stabbed a dozen times, his door locked from the inside. Without a shred of doubt, one of his fellow passengers is the murderer.<br/>Isolated by the storm, detective Hercule Poirot must find the killer among a dozen of the dead man’s enemies, before the murderer decides to strike again.
